Step1: Recall Triangle Side - Angle Relationship
In a triangle, the larger angle is opposite the longer side, and the smaller angle is opposite the shorter side (Law of Sines: $\frac{a}{\sin A}=\frac{b}{\sin B}=\frac{c}{\sin C}$ implies that if $A > B$, then $a > b$).
Step2: Analyze Given Angles and Sides
In the triangle formed by the diagonal, we have one angle of $87^{\circ}$ and another angle of $84^{\circ}$. Since $87^{\circ}>84^{\circ}$, the side opposite $87^{\circ}$ should be longer than the side opposite $84^{\circ}$. The side opposite $87^{\circ}$ is 11, and the side opposite $84^{\circ}$ is 13. But $11 < 13$, which violates the side - angle relationship.
